2016-10-18Revert "usb: dwc2: gadget: fix TX FIFO size and address initialization"John Youn1-8/+39
This reverts commit aa381a7259c3 ("usb: dwc2: gadget: fix TX FIFO size and address initialization"). The original commit removed the FIFO size programming per endpoint. The DPTXFSIZn register is also used for DIEPTXFn and the SIZE field is r/w in dedicated fifo mode. So it isn't appropriate to simply remove this initialization as it might break existing behavior. Also, some cores might not have enough fifo space to handle the programming method used in the reverted patch, resulting in fifo initialization failure. 2016-08-31usb: dwc2: gadget: fix TX FIFO size and address initializationRobert Baldyga1-39/+8
According to DWC2 documentation, DPTxFSize field of DPTXFSIZn register is read only, which means that software cannot change FIFO size. Register description says: "The value of this register is the Largest Device Mode Periodic Tx Data FIFO Depth (parameter OTG_TX_DPERIO_DFIFO_DEPTH_n), as specified during coreConsultant configuration." That means, that we have to setup only FIFO start addresses (DPTxFStAddr), taking into account reset values of DPTxFSize. Initialize FIFO start addresses properly and remove unneeded core related to incorrect FIFO size initialization. 2016-06-21usb: dwc2: gadget: Add EP disabled interrupt handlerVardan Mikayelyan1-17/+70
Reimplemented EP disabled interrupt handler and moved to corresponding function. This interrupt indicates that the endpoint has been disabled per the application's request. For IN endpoints flushes txfifo, in case of BULK clears DCTL_CGNPINNAK, in case of ISOC completes current request. For ISOC-OUT endpoints completes expired requests. If there is remaining request starts it. This is the part of ISOC-OUT transfer drop flow. When ISOC-OUT transfer expired we must disable ep to drop ongoing transfer. 2016-06-21usb: dwc2: gadget: Add Incomplete ISO IN/OUT Interrupt handlersVardan Mikayelyan1-49/+124
Incomplete ISO IN interrupt indicates one of the following conditions occurred while transmitting an ISOC transaction. - Corrupted IN Token for ISOC EP. - Packet not complete in FIFO. Incomplete ISO OUT indicates that there is at least one isochronous OUT endpoint on which the transfer is not completed in the current microframe. The following actions will be taken: In case of EP-IN - Determine the EP - Disable EP directly from this handler; when "Endpoint Disabled" interrupt is received flush FIFO In case of EP-OUT - Determine the EP - If target frame elapsed set DCTL_SGOUTNAK, unmask GOUTNAKEFF and proceed as described in section 7.5.1 of DWC-HSOTG Programming Guide Also added dwc2_gadget_target_frame_elapsed() helper function which will be used in Incomplete ISO IN/OUT Interrupt handlers. 2016-06-21usb: dwc2: gadget: Add OUTTKNEPDIS and NAKINTRPT handlersVardan Mikayelyan1-0/+94
NAKINTRPT interrupt is starting point for isoc-in transfer, synchronization done with first in token received from host, core asserts this interrupt when responds with 0 length data to in token, received from host. The first IN token is asynchronous for device - device does not know when first one token will arrive from host. On first token arrival HW generates 2 interrupts: 'in token received while FIFO empty' and 'NAK'. NAK interrupt for ISOC in means that token has arrived and ZLP was sent in response to that as there was no data in FIFO. SW is basing on this interrupt to obtain frame in which token has come and then based on the interval calculates next frame for transfer. OUTTKNEPDIS interrupt is starting point for isoc-out transfer, synchronization done with first out token received from host while corresponding ep is disabled. For OUTs the reason is same - device does not know initial frame in which out token will come. For this HW generates OUTTKNEPDIS - out token is received while EP is disabled. Upon getting this interrupt SW starts calculation for next transfer frame. 2015-10-14usb: dwc2: refactor common low-level hw code to platform.cMarek Szyprowski1-169/+17
DWC2 module on some platforms needs three additional hardware resources: phy controller, clock and power supply. All of them must be enabled/activated to properly initialize and operate. This was initially handled in s3c-hsotg driver, which has been converted to 'gadget' part of dwc2 driver. Unfortunately, not all of this code got moved to common platform code, what resulted in accessing DWC2 registers without enabling low-level hardware resources. This fails for example on Exynos SoCs. This patch moves all the code for managing those resources to common platform.c file and provides convenient wrappers for controlling them. 2015-10-02usb: dwc2: gadget: parity fix in isochronous modeRoman Bacik1-8/+63
USB OTG driver in isochronous mode has to set the parity of the receiving microframe. The parity is set to even by default. This causes problems for an audio gadget, if the host starts transmitting on odd microframes. This fix uses Incomplete Periodic Transfer interrupt to toggle between even and odd parity until the Transfer Complete interrupt is received.
